A Postgraduate Certificate in Health Data Translation equips students with the crucial skills needed to navigate the complex landscape of health information. The program focuses on translating complex medical data into easily understandable formats for various stakeholders, fostering improved communication and decision-making within healthcare.


Learning outcomes typically include mastering data standardization techniques, developing proficiency in data visualization and interpretation, and gaining expertise in health informatics and data privacy regulations (HIPAA, GDPR). Students also gain valuable experience in working with large datasets, using tools like SQL and R for analysis. The curriculum often integrates real-world case studies to enhance practical application of theoretical concepts.


The duration of a Postgraduate Certificate in Health Data Translation program varies, typically ranging from a few months to a year, depending on the institution and the intensity of the program. Many programs offer flexible learning options, accommodating students with professional commitments.

A Postgraduate Certificate in Health Data Translation is increasingly significant in the UK's rapidly evolving healthcare landscape. The NHS is undergoing a digital transformation, generating vast amounts of data requiring skilled professionals to interpret and utilise this information effectively. According to NHS Digital, over 90% of NHS Trusts now utilise electronic patient records, highlighting the urgent need for individuals proficient in health data translation.

This certificate equips graduates with the necessary skills to manage, analyse, and interpret complex health datasets. The ability to translate raw data into actionable insights is crucial for improving patient care, optimising resource allocation, and informing strategic decision-making. The UK government's investment in data-driven healthcare initiatives further strengthens the demand for professionals with expertise in this field. For example, the Office for National Statistics reported a 25% increase in health data-related job postings in 2022 compared to 2021.
